Urbandale board to rework bullying and complaint policy after debate over protected-class language
Summary
Trustees discussed moving complaint and appeal procedures into a new Policy 105 to clarify reporting and appeals, aligning language with recent state law (House File 865). Staff will bring a draft for board review at the Jan. 12 meeting; no vote was taken tonight.
At a meeting of the Urbandale Community School Board (date not specified in the transcript), trustees spent substantial time discussing a proposed new district policy to clarify bullying, harassment and complaint procedures.
Unidentified Speaker 7 (Administrator) introduced proposed Policy 105 as a reorganization of parts of existing Policy 5.45, saying it would move appeal and complaint procedures into the 100 series and separate associated exhibits (complaint forms, witness forms and investigative procedures) so parents, staff and students can more easily find and use them.
